General Description The NCP2824 is a Mono class D audio amplifier featuring a preamplifier stage, a PWM stage and an H−Bridge stage with an automatic Gain control circuitry which performs the non clipping function. Non Clipping Function In the presence of an exceeded input signal, when the audio signal is going to be clipped, the gain of the audio amplifier automatically decreases as defined by the AGC operation ...
